2009 SESSION
HB 2050 Claims; Teddy Pierries Thompson.
Introduced by: Thomas D. Gear | all patrons ... notes | add to my profiles
SUMMARY AS PASSED: (all summaries)
Claims; Teddy Pierries Thompson. Provides relief to Teddy Pierries Thompson, who was incarcerated from May 8, 2000, to September 10, 2007. His conviction was vacated on September 10, 2007. The compensation award is in an amount equal to 90 percent of the Virginia per capita personal income as reported by the Bureau of Economic Analysis of the United States Department of Commerce for each year of Thompson's incarceration. The payment of the award will be in an initial lump sum of $51,999 to be paid on or before August 1, 2009, and the sum of $207,996 to be used to purchase an annuity to be paid out in monthly payments over 25 years commencing September 1, 2009. In addition, the bill entitles Thompson receive reimbursement up to $10,000 for tuition for career and technical training within the Virginia Community College System.

HISTORY
- 01/13/09 House: Prefiled and ordered printed; offered 01/14/09 091315512
- 01/13/09 House: Referred to Committee on Appropriations
- 01/20/09 House: Assigned App. sub: Technology Oversight & Government Activities (Landes)
- 01/27/09 House: Subcommittee recommends reporting with amendment(s)
- 01/28/09 House: Reported from Appropriations with substitute (23-Y 0-N)
- 01/28/09 House: Committee substitute printed 092418512-H1
- 01/30/09 House: Read first time
- 02/02/09 House: Read second time
- 02/02/09 House: Committee substitute agreed to 092418512-H1
- 02/02/09 House: Engrossed by House - committee substitute HB2050H1
- 02/03/09 House: Read third time and passed House BLOCK VOTE (98-Y 0-N)
- 02/03/09 House: VOTE: BLOCK VOTE PASSAGE (98-Y 0-N)
- 02/04/09 Senate: Constitutional reading dispensed
- 02/04/09 Senate: Referred to Committee on Finance
- 02/17/09 Senate: Reported from Finance (16-Y 0-N)
- 02/18/09 Senate: Constitutional reading dispensed (40-Y 0-N)
- 02/19/09 Senate: Read third time
- 02/19/09 Senate: Passed Senate (40-Y 0-N)
- 02/24/09 House: Enrolled
- 02/24/09 House: Bill text as passed House and Senate (HB2050ER)
- 02/25/09 House: Signed by Speaker
- 02/27/09 Senate: Signed by President
- 03/27/09 Governor: Approved by Governor-Chapter 360 (effective 7/1/09)
